What is 93/62 Divided By 1/4

Answer: 9362÷14\frac{93}{62}\div\frac{1}{4} = 61\frac{6}{1}

Solving 9362÷14\frac{93}{62}\div\frac{1}{4}

  • Rewrite the Division as Multiplication by the Reciprocal:

9362÷14=9362×41\frac{93}{62} \div \frac{1}{4} = \frac{93}{62} \times \frac{4}{1}

  • Multiply the Numerators: 93×4=37293 \times 4 = 372
  • Multiply the Denominators: 62×1=6262 \times 1 = 62
  • Form the New Fraction: 9362×14=37262\frac{93}{62} \times \frac{1}{4} = \frac{372}{62}

Let's Simplify 37262\frac{372}{62}

  • Find the Greatest Common Divisor (GCD) of 372372 and 6262. The GCD of 372372 and 6262 is 6262.
  • Divide both the numerator and the denominator by the GCD:372÷6262÷62=61\frac{372 \div 62}{62 \div 62} = \frac{6}{1}

Answer 9362÷14=61\frac{93}{62}\div\frac{1}{4} = \frac{6}{1}
